Weeks ago, out in the Can-Am with my husband, we saw 2
eagles gorging on a kangaroo. An ear torn off, brains out,
intestines strewn on the ground, the kill was so fresh it hadn’t begun to smell.

I’d just watched ‘Sense and Sensibility’ and was having a good cry at the outcome I already knew. Looking outside, I gasped; holding my hand to my chest as a melodramatic creature from a bonnet drama
might do. Two Wedge-tailed Eagles were copycatting each other, circle gliding in the thermals above our
home. One slowly spiraled down, while the other spun higher in a classic
mirror image.
